Financial Performance - On August 1, 2025, Fluor reported Q2 2025 financial results and lowered its full-year guidance, attributing the poor performance to rising costs in infrastructure projects due to subcontractor design errors, price increases, and scheduling delays [3]. - Customers are reportedly reducing capital spending, further impacting Fluor's financial outlook [3]. - Following the announcement, Fluor's stock price decreased by $15.35 per share, or 27.03%, closing at $41.42 per share on August 5, 2025 [3].
